The crew of a cruising sailboat visits the Kamoka Pearl Farm on the atoll of Ahi in the Tuamotu Archipelago to observe the pearl cultivation process.6:13 They learn that the farm adheres to sustainable practices, including the use of solar and wind power and the maintenance of a healthy local fish population to clean the oysters.9:51 The production cycle for a single Tahitian black pearl, from grafting the nucleus into the *Pinctada margaritifera* oyster to harvest, spans four to five years.12:18 The crew assists with stringing oysters and placing them in baskets for growth.8:44
Following their stay at Ahi, the crew navigates an outgoing pass with a three-knot current, noting the difficulty of timing slack tide in the region.15:48 They later travel to a local airport by dinghy to retrieve a new sail, navigating rough conditions to complete the delivery.24:29 The crew emphasizes their commitment to minimizing engine use, having consumed only a quarter tank of fuel since departing Mexico.13:40
